Aquests són els comandaments més comuns utilitzats en una Raspberry Pi

ordres

Si alguna vegada t'has posat a treballar i configurar el teu Raspberry Pi, segur que t'hauràs perdut entre l'enorme quantitat de ordres que existeixen, són molts els que has aprendre't de memòria o, al menys, tenir sempre a mà en una llista per així poder consultar-los quan ho necessitis. Amb això en ment, avui m'he proposat crear una llista amb els més freqüents, uns segurament els coneguis i altres potser no tant.

Abans de continuar, cal tenir en compte que en Linux hi ha dos tipus d'usuaris diferents a l' accedir a l'Terminal, Un és l'usuari 'normal'Amb permisos d'accés bàsics i l'altre és la manera conegut com root o superusuari que pràcticament pot fer el que vulgui. En aquest punt cal tenir especial cura ja que, quan dic 'el que vulgui'És literalment el que vulgui amb tot el que això significa com pot ser esborrar arxius que literalment inutilitzin a sistema operatiu.

Com és lògic, algunes de les ordres a utilitzar no poden ser llançats per un usuari bàsic pel que necessitaràs permisos de root per poder executar aquestes ordres pel que serà bastant comú que vegis el prefix sudo davant de la comanda en concret. Una altra forma d'accedir a l'superusuari sense necessitat de posar sudo davant de tots els ordres és executant l'ordre suo seva i posar el password d'aquest. Un cop haguem canviat d'usuari podrem veure a l'indicador d'ordres una mena root @ Raspberry Pi: / home / pi #, D'aquesta manera ja no caldrà posar el prefix sudo davant de cada comanda.

Amb aquesta petita aclaració, pas a listarte les ordres que personalment crec que són necessaris i sobretot útils a l'hora de configurar o treballar amb la nostra Raspberry Pi:

màquina arcade
Article relacionat:
Crea la teva pròpia màquina arcade amb Raspberry Pi

Comandaments Generals:

  • apt-get update: Actualitza la vostra versió del Raspbian.
  • actualització apt-get: Actualitza tots els paquets que tens instal·lats al sistema.
  • clear: Neteja la finestra de l'terminal.
  • data: Mostra la data actual.
  • find / -name prova.txt: Cerca a tot el sistema l'arxiu prueba.txt i genera una llista de tots els directoris que contenen l'arxiu.
  • nano prova.txt: Obre l'arxiu prueba.txt a "Nano", l'editor de text de Linux.
  • apagar: Apaga el sistema de manera immediata.
  • raspi-config: Obre el menú de configuració.
  • reiniciar: Reinicia el sistema de manera immediata.
  • apagar -h ara: Apaga el sistema de manera immediata.
  • apagada -h 18:34: Apaga el sistema a les 18:34.
  • startx: Obre la interfície gràfica d'usuari.

Ordres per a fitxers i directoris:

  • cat prova.txt: Mostra el contingut de l'arxiu prova.txt.
  • cd / abc / xyz: Canvia el directori actual a directori / abc / xyz.
  • cp XXXCopia el archivo o directorio XXX y lo pega en una ubicación especificada. Un exemple d'aquesta ordre seria: cp fichero.txt /home/pi/fichero.txt en el directorio actual y lo pega en el directorio /home/pi/. Si el archivo no está en el directorio actual debes poner la dirección donde se encuentra.
  • ls-l: Mostra una llista amb els arxius presents en el directori actual a més d'altres dades interessants com la mida de l'arxiu, la data de modificació i els permisos.
  • mkdir carpeta_prova: Crea una nova carpeta carpeta_prueba dins de la carpeta actual.
  • mv XXX: Mou el fitxer o carpeta anomenat XXX a una localització específica. Un exemple d'aquesta ordre seria: mv fitxer.txt / home / pi que mouria fitxer.txt present en l'actual carpeta a l'adreça / home / pi. Si el fitxer que volem moure no es troba a la carpeta on ens trobem hem d'afegir l'adreça completa del mateix. Aquesta comanda també pot ser utilitzat per a canviar el nom arxius o carpetes, l'únic que hem de fer és moure en el mateix directori però amb diferent nom, per exemple: mv fitxer.txt prueba.txt renombraría el fitxer fitxer.txt com prova.txt.
  • rm prova.txt: Esborra el fitxer prova.txt
  • rmdir carpeta_prova: Esborra la carpeta carpeta_prueba. Aquesta acció només pot efectuar-se si la carpeta està buida.
  • scp user@10.0.0.32: /some/path/file.txtCopia un archivo a través de SSH. Se puede utilizar para descargar un archivo de un ordenador remoto a nuestra Raspberry Pi. usuari@10.0.0.32 es el nombre de usuario y la dirección es la IP local del ordenador remoto y /ruta/path/archivo.txt es la ruta y el nombre de archivo del archivo en el ordenador remoto.
  • tocar: Crea un fitxer nou buit en el directori actual.

Ordres per configuració de xarxes:

  • ifconfig: Serveix per comprovar l'estat de la connexió sense fils que estem utilitzant, per exemple per veure si wlan0 té assignada o no una adreça IP.
  • iwconfig: Per comprovar a quina xarxa estem connectats sense fils.
  • escaneig iwlist wlan0: Mostra una llista amb totes les xarxes sense fils disponibles.
  • iwlist wlan0 scan | grep ESSID: Si a l'ordre anterior afegim | grep juntament amb el nom d'un camp, el sistema ens mostrarà per pantalla tan sols el camp que necestiamos. Utilitzant l'ordre d'exemple tan sols es llistarà el camp ESSID.
  • nmap: Escaneja la teva xarxa i llista els dispositius connectats, el nombre de port, el protocol, el sistema operatiu, les adreces MAC ...
  • fer pingPrueba la conectividad entre dos dispositivos conectados a una  misma red. Por ejemplo, ping 10.0.0.32 enviará un paquete al dispositivo con IP 10.0.0.32 y esperará una respuesta. También funciona con las direcciones de sitios web lo que nos puede ayudar a saber si tenemos conexión a la red o no utilizando, por ejemplo, ping www.google.es
  • wget http://www.miweb.com/prueba.txt: Descarrega l'arxiu prueba.txt des de la pàgina web www.miweb.com i el guarda en el directori actual.
servidor web
Article relacionat:
Configura el teu Raspberry Pi com un servidor web

Ordres d'informació de sistema:

  • cat / proc / meminfo: Mostra informació sobre el nostre sistema de memòria.
  • cat / proc / partitions: Mostra la mida i el nombre de particions de la targeta SD o del disc dur.
  • cat / proc / version: Ens mostra la versió de la Raspberry Pi que estem utilitzant.
  • df-h: Mostra l'espai disponible al disc.
  • df /: Mostra quant espai lliure en disc hi ha disponible.
  • dpkg -get-selections | grep XXX: Llista els paquets instal·lats relacionats amb XXX.
  • dpkg -get-selections: Dóna informació sobre tots els paquets instal·lats.
  • lliure: Mostra la quantitat de memòria lliure de què disposa el sistema.
  • nom d'amfitrió -I: Mostra l'adreça IP de la nostra Raspberry Pi.
  • lsusb: Ens ofereix informació sobre tots els dispositius USB connectats a la nostra Raspberry Pi.
  • Tecla UPAl pulsar la tecla UP se introduce el último comando ingresado en el símbolo del sistema. Esta es una manera rápida de corregir los comandos que se hicieron en error.
  • vcgencmd mesure_temp: Mostra la temperatura de la CPU.
  • vcgencmd get_mem arm && vcgencmd get_mem gpu: Mostra la memòria dividida entre la CPU i la GPU.

Sigues el primer a comentar

Deixa el teu comentari

La seva adreça de correu electrònic no es publicarà. Els camps obligatoris estan marcats amb *

*

*

  1. Responsable de les dades: Miguel Ángel Gatón
  2. Finalitat de les dades: Controlar l'SPAM, gestió de comentaris.
  3. Legitimació: El teu consentiment
  4. Comunicació de les dades: No es comunicaran les dades a tercers excepte per obligació legal.
  5. Emmagatzematge de les dades: Base de dades allotjada en Occentus Networks (UE)
  6. Drets: En qualsevol moment pots limitar, recuperar i esborrar la teva informació.